The city government does not plan to raise fares in the Kharkiv metro.

Kharkiv mayor Igor Terekhov stated this today, February 15, during a meeting with the workforce of the Kharkiv Metro KP.

We won't raise metro fares. This is good for city residents, but not very good for an enterprise, because the level of your salaries and profitability depend on the tariff. And for this, the city will support the metro financially, and we will also consider the possibility of providing subway workers with benefits for housing and communal services,” Terekhov said..

Earlier, Terekhov said that the construction of the metro is a priority for local authorities..
